How Percentage Decrease is Calculated
The Percentage Decrease Calculator determines the reduction from an initial value to a final value, expressed as a percentage of the initial value.
Percentage Decrease Formula
$$ \text{Percentage Decrease} = \frac{\text{Starting Value} – \text{Final Value}}{|\text{Starting Value}|} \times 100 $$
Steps to Calculate:
- Subtract the Final Value from the Starting Value to find the absolute change.
- Divide the change amount by the absolute value of the Starting Value.
- Multiply the result by $100$ to convert the decimal ratio into a percentage.
Note: If the result is a negative percentage, it indicates a percentage *increase* rather than a decrease.
